

Olney FFA Banquet
On May 13, the Olney FFA held its annual banquet to showcase the achievements of its members. The evening’s ceremony began with a welcome from the Olney chapter president Natalie Del Villar, followed by an invocation by Ari Livingston.
The Green Hand Ceremony was performed by Kami Bednarz and chapter degrees was handed out by Chloe Neal. The evening progressed after a delicious meal of fajitas, by an awards ceremony performed by various Olney FFA officers. The awards were many, as this year’s Olney FFA did very well in competitions.
Highlights from the evening of awards include the Senior Chapter Conducting team who ended 2nd in district and 10th in area, the team included: Natalie Del Villar, Gatlin Guy, Ellie Hinson, Mallory Jeske, Ari Livingston and Noah Pint. The Greenhand Quiz team of Gatlin Guy, Ellie Hinson, Mallory Jeske and Brady Lisle finished 2nd in district and 8th in area. The Greenhand Skills team of Angel Alvarado, Brianna Galindo and Peyton Valdez finished 2nd in district and 9th in area. Ari Livingston finished 2nd in district and area, advancing for Job Interview. The Wildlife team made up of Kohl Bowers, Sydney Craig, Tucker Heard, Mallory Jeske and Julia Lewis finished 2nd in district.
The Land team of Angel Alvarado, Sydney Craig, Ellie Hinson and Ari Livingston finished 2nd in district and 10th in area. Julia Lewis finished 3rd in district for Extemporaneous Speaking and 2nd in district for Senior Prepared Public Speaking.
